GALLOWAY TOWNSHIP – Sons of Serendip will be back by popular demand 7:30 p.m. Friday, Nov. 3 to perform hits from their catalog of albums on the main stage of Stockton University’s Performing Arts Center.

Billboard charting quartet Sons of Serendip won the hearts of fans and judges alike as finalists on NBC’s “America’s Got Talent” with their ethereal and emotionally stirring interpretations of pop music, arranged with a unique blend of vocals, harp, piano and cello.

It was serendipity that brought the four members of Sons of Serendip together. Lead vocalist Micah Christian, cellist and vocalist Kendall Ramseur, pianist Cordaro Rodriguez and harpist Mason Morton met when they were graduate students at Boston University. But it was talent, dedication and a desire to share their music with the world that rocketed the quartet to fame.

With four successful albums, “Sons of Serendip,” “Christmas: Beyond the Lights,” “Life + Love” and “Mosaic,” and soulful live performances, Sons of Serendip has lifted audiences to a sublime experience both nationally and internationally.
